All Canadian-approved lifejackets and PFDs are labelled in English and French, must show that the device has been approved by: ____ or ____

In Canada, lifejackets and PFDs must be approved by Transport Canada or the Canadian Coast Guard. These approvals are indicated on labels in English and French on the safety devices.

The question pertains to the standards for Canadian-approved lifejackets and Personal Flotation Devices (PFDs). In Canada, all lifejackets and PFDs must be approved by one of two organizations: Transport Canada or the Canadian Coast Guard. This approval ensures that the devices meet specific safety requirements and can properly aid in keeping individuals afloat in water. In addition to being labeled in both English and French, these devices will carry a label showing that they have been certified by one or both of these authorities, highlighting adherence to Canadian safety regulations.
